Output 0ecf987dbf0dbbc425f30e8f4ad4c005b40122e991d8917b554ab48a0d9a2d60:1

value
596950267
script pubkey
OP_0 OP_PUSHBYTES_20 a1ef4d55b6f9de8da75b7d5d736bd3b8ca241301
address
tb1q58h564dkl80gmf6m04whx67nhr9zgycpz877ng
transaction
0ecf987dbf0dbbc425f30e8f4ad4c005b40122e991d8917b554ab48a0d9a2d60
confirmations
37413
spent
true